Hello Mathieu,
I looked into this. So, I can silent sparse by using __force sparse
annotation, but that's not the full solution. I think to properly
address these warnings use of ioremap*() APIs should be replaced with
memremap() API. This ensures that DDR reserved memory is not mapped as
iomem, and correct pointer type is returned.
However, this needs serious restructure in the driver. It will take me
some more time to address this issue. Until then I prefer to keep the
sparse warnings.
